Create a renderer instance.
#### options.base (optional)
The base public path to serve bundled assets from. See the Vite
documentation for more information.
#### options.cwd (optional)
Set the cwd when compiling and generating the site. It's only necessary to set
this when your build script is not in the directory you're generating your site
from.
If no value is passed, process.cwd() is used by default.
#### options.output (optional)

#### options.render
Type: object
##### options.render.client
Type: string
Path to a module that exports a function that renders a component in the
browser. The module must export a function as the default export with the
following signature:

##### options.render.document (optional)
Function to use to render the document HTML. The function must implement the
following signature:

##### options.render.server
Function to use when rendering components on the server. The function must
implement the following signature:

#### options.templates
Type: { [name: string]: string }
An object that maps template names to file paths.
#### options.viteConfig (optional)
Type: vite.UserConfig
Custom vite configuration.
Compiles and writes the application's bundle to the public output directory.
